I had 2 MP40's on the back wall of a 60x18 110. It worked fine. I had some sand disturbance in certain areas but nothing major. My sand was finer than most aragonite so for most that would not be an issue.
 
i have 2 of the mp40's in my 240 gallon in the fig A setup. one is master other is slave and is in anti-sync mode. Works good for me no toilet effect, but my aquarium is 6 foot long.
 
One thing about vortech powrheads if you the right amount of power heads for the tank size. There will be no dead spots where ever you place them. I would do figer B.
